suitsiidsmõtteid, a term originating from Estonian, translates to "suicidal thoughts." These are preoccupations with or an inclination to end one's own life. Such thoughts can range in intensity from fleeting considerations to detailed plans. They are often a symptom of underlying mental health conditions such as depression, anxiety disorders, bipolar disorder, or schizophrenia, but can also arise from acute stress, trauma, or feelings of hopelessness and despair.
